Painkiller Hell & Damnationhas been out on PC since Halloween, just long enough that I had forgotten console versions of the no-nonsense first-person shooter were ever announced. They were, and according to a new update from Nordic Games, P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 gamers will have to continue waiting until July 03, 2025.

“We have been working around the clock to bring the Xbox 360 and PS3 versions of the game in line with the quality and standard of the PC game,” explained production and business development manager Reinhard Pollice. “There has been a slight delay so that the console communities can enjoy the fiendishly ghoulish experience that we know they want and deserve. In taking this additional time to add the final touches, we know that players will realize that the best things do come to those who wait!”
